iOS系统升级详解:机制、风险与最佳实践325


iOS系统升级是苹果公司定期向用户推送的新版操作系统,包含了性能提升、新功能添加、安全漏洞修复等诸多方面的内容。理解iOS系统升级的机制、潜在风险以及最佳实践对于用户保持设备安全和获得最佳使用体验至关重要。本文将从操作系统的角度深入探讨iOS系统升级的方方面面。

一、iOS系统升级的机制

iOS系统升级并非简单的文件替换。它是一个复杂的多阶段过程,涉及到多个系统组件的协调工作。首先,设备会检查苹果服务器,确认是否有可用的新系统版本。一旦发现新版本,设备会下载相应的升级包。这个升级包并非简单的操作系统镜像,而是一个包含了系统文件、配置信息以及升级程序的完整软件包。下载完成后,升级程序会开始工作,它会进行一系列检查,确保设备满足升级要求,例如存储空间是否足够、电池电量是否充足等。 接下来,升级程序会进入一个关键阶段:系统分区更新。这个过程通常涉及到对系统分区进行擦除和重新写入,这需要相当的时间和资源。为了保证数据安全,升级程序会在更新过程中进行校验和保护。最后,系统会重新启动,加载新的操作系统。整个过程完成后,用户可以开始使用新的iOS系统。

从操作系统的角度来看,iOS系统升级是一个典型的“就地升级”(in-place upgrade)过程。它不同于一些操作系统采用完全的“全新安装”(clean install),而是尽可能地复用现有的系统分区,以缩短升级时间并减少用户数据丢失的风险。 然而,“就地升级”也意味着升级包中可能包含一些旧系统的残留文件,尽管这些文件通常会被清除,但在极少数情况下可能会导致一些问题。苹果公司通过严格的软件工程和测试流程来最大程度地降低这种风险。

二、iOS系统升级的潜在风险

尽管iOS系统升级通常是安全的,但潜在的风险依然存在。最常见的问题包括:升级失败、数据丢失以及兼容性问题。

升级失败可能是由于网络连接中断、存储空间不足、设备硬件故障或升级包本身存在问题造成的。一旦升级失败,设备可能会陷入死机状态,需要进行恢复操作。数据丢失则可能发生在升级过程中,虽然苹果公司采取了各种措施来防止数据丢失,但仍然存在一定的风险,尤其是在升级过程中遇到中断的情况下。一些用户报告过在升级后部分数据丢失的情况,这通常与升级程序未能正确处理用户数据有关。

兼容性问题也是一个值得关注的方面。虽然苹果公司会进行严格的测试,但一些旧设备或第三方应用程序可能与新的iOS系统存在不兼容性。这可能导致应用程序无法正常运行,甚至出现系统崩溃的情况。一些旧硬件可能在升级后性能下降,或者某些功能无法正常使用。

三、iOS系统升级的最佳实践

为了最大程度地降低升级风险,用户应该采取以下措施:

1. 备份数据: 在升级前,务必备份所有重要的数据,包括照片、视频、联系人、应用数据等。可以使用iCloud、iTunes或其他备份工具进行备份。这能够在升级失败时有效地恢复数据。

2. 检查网络连接: 确保网络连接稳定,拥有足够的带宽来下载升级包。不稳定的网络连接是升级失败的主要原因之一。

3. 确保充足的存储空间: 升级包通常需要占用大量的存储空间,确保设备有足够的可用空间来完成升级。如果空间不足,升级程序会提示用户释放空间。

4. 检查电池电量: 升级过程需要消耗大量的电量,确保设备电池电量充足,避免升级过程中因电量不足而中断。

5. 阅读升级说明: 在升级前,仔细阅读苹果公司提供的升级说明,了解新版本的功能特性以及潜在的问题。这有助于用户做出更明智的升级决策。

6. 选择合适的升级时机: 选择一个时间充裕、网络稳定的时间进行升级,避免在紧急情况下进行升级。

7. 升级后进行测试: 升级完成后,对关键应用程序进行测试,确保它们能够正常运行。如果发现任何问题,可以联系苹果公司寻求帮助。

四、总结

iOS系统升级是保持设备安全和获得最佳使用体验的关键步骤。理解其背后的机制和潜在风险,并采取最佳实践,能够有效地降低升级过程中的风险,确保升级顺利完成。 通过提前做好准备,用户可以充分利用iOS系统升级带来的新功能和性能提升,享受更流畅、更安全的移动设备体验。

2025-05-31


上一篇:Android系统崩溃及恢复:深度解析与解决方案

下一篇:Linux与Windows系统:架构、特性及差异比较